Was convicted of fatally beating Ronnie Waddell, 35, and James Kepley, 57, in rural Davidson County on March 19, 1984. The two homeless men were killed with a claw hammer. Laws was sentenced to death on August 20, 1985. On July 26, 1989, the North Carolina Supreme Court affirmed Laws' death sentence on direct appeal. Wayne Laws is the inmate who has spent the longest time on North Carolina death row.
